    Default Return to turning

    I have today for the first time in 7 yrs turned the VL300 on. Due to an accident and MS I have no feeling in both arms and not much muscle strength. So I,m really pleased with his project it,s a modified version of my cheese, bickey and dip platters. NG Rosewood and alloy tea candle holder
